搜索
编程论坛
→
.NET专区
→
『 C# 论坛 』
→ 请教:textBox的keydown事件
标题:
请教:textBox的keydown事件
只看楼主
酒肉弥勒佛
等 级:
新手上路
威 望:
8
帖 子:399
专家分:0
注 册:2006-6-6
楼主
问题点数:0 回复次数:1
请教:textBox的keydown事件
请教下:我控制textBox只能输入数字,是不是在textBox的keydown事件下写代码?可是我找不到他的keydown事件,请问下该怎么办,object sender, System.EventArgs e,这两个参数指什么,谢谢
搜索更多相关主题的帖子:
keydown事件
textBox
数字
sender
2006-06-14 18:14
xxxxx52
等 级:
贵宾
威 望:
13
帖 子:689
专家分:0
注 册:2006-4-30
第
2
楼
得分:0
private void txtPho_KeyPress(object sender, System.Windows.Forms.KeyPressEventArgs e)
{
if(e.KeyChar!='\b')
{
if(e.KeyChar!='-'||e.KeyChar!='+')
{
if((e.KeyChar<'0')||(e.KeyChar>'9'))
{
e.Handled = true;
}
}
}
}
然后再将textBox控件的IMEMode属性设为disable 就是禁用输入法
用KeyPress事件 上面的代码是 允许在textBox里面输入回车,-,+,0,1,2。。。。9
你自己研究研究吧
好的资料下载网站http:///in.asp?id=xuelion2006 嘿嘿帮点一下拉~
2006-06-15 09:14
2
1/1页
1
参与讨论请移步原网站贴子:
https://bbs.bccn.net/thread-72333-1-1.html
关于我们
|
广告合作
|
编程中国
|
清除Cookies
|
TOP
|
手机版
编程中国
版权所有,并保留所有权利。
Powered by
Discuz
, Processed in 1.836555 second(s), 7 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ved